It's been almost a week since the Dancing With the Stars Season 28 cast was unveiled, and one pro is still trying to move on. 

Artem Chigvintsev was ominously missing from the list of pros taking part. 

More upsetting is that he learned about being cut just days ahead of the cast reveal.

“Obviously, it was a massive shock,” the dancer revealed on Nikki and Brie Bella‘s “The Bellas Podcast” on Wednesday, August 28.

“It’s not even a job; it’s a lifestyle if you’ve been doing it for a very long time," he continued.

"There was never a thought in my mind that I’m not going to be doing it. There’s always a chance, as a pro, you might be doing some performances on the show, and there’s still an involvement in some sort.

But getting this call, [hearing] ‘There’s gonna be no involvement in the show from now on,’ it’s like going through a breakup after 10 years.”

Artem has been with the ABC competition series since 2014, so being cut completely is a big thing. 

Upon joining the cast in 2014, he was part of the dance troupe, later scoring a promotion to professional dancer. 

He said during the podcast that he understood he might be demoted back to the dance troupe, but being let go from the series as a whole was a shock. 

He had been texting with producers for two weeks before the announcement, and there was nothing in those messages that suggested he would not be returning.

The cookie crumbled for Artem after a conversation with his brother in which he was asked who he was partnered with. 

He contacted producers the Friday before the cast reveal and was told he would get a response by the end of the day. 

He did, and that's when he learned about his fate on the show. 

“I dedicated 10 years of my life to that company and being let go a few days before the announcement, that’s, like, a punch in the stomach really,” he said. “I can’t let any one decide my fate from now on.”

Nikki, who is now dating Artem, also had some words about the whole scenario. 

“They’ve had these dancers on hold since March,” she said.

“They don’t give them compensation for it. They’ve been all unemployed since March. … That made me really upset because how do you put people on hold and then cut them last minute?”
